The Microsponge Delivery System (MDS) is a novel medicine delivery technique. To lessen systemic exposure and local cutaneous responses to active ingredients, topical medication solutions have included MDS technology to enable the controlled release of the active ingredient into the skin. Clinical trials using microsponge technology have been conducted. several active components in complete formulations, supporting robust product claims. The term "microsponge" refers to a group of extremely small. drug delivery systems control the rate or type of release of drugs to certain parts of the body. Transdermal drug delivery uses the skin as a portal of entry for drugs. Microsponge technology changes the release and absorption properties of drugs by binding them to a carrier. The delivery of microsponge medicine provides a package of ingredients and is expected to help reduce side effects and increase elegance, durability, and ease of use. Additionally, many studies have confirmed that microsponge bacteria are non-toxic, non-mutagenic, non-irritating, and non-allergenic. Today, sunscreens, cosmetics, over-the-counter skin care products, and cosmetics all use these tools. This type of drug delivery could help us understand the treatment of many diseases. Therefore, drug delivery systems based on microsponge can be developed into useful pharmaceutical materials for various medical applications.
